首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库中保存图片路径

MySQL数据库是一种开源的关系型数据库管理系统,它支持存储、管理和查询各种类型的数据,包括文本、数值、图像等。在MySQL数据库中保存图片路径是一种常见的做法,它可以将图片的存储路径作为一个字符串类型的字段保存在数据库中。

保存图片路径的好处是可以在数据库中轻松地查找和管理图片数据。以下是完善且全面的答案:

概念: 在MySQL数据库中保存图片路径是指将图片的物理存储路径作为一个字段保存在数据库的特定表中。

分类: 将图片路径保存在数据库中是一种数据库设计的方法,属于数据存储和管理的范畴。

优势:

  1. 数据关联性强:通过将图片路径与其他数据字段关联,可以轻松地实现图片与其他数据的关联,比如用户头像、产品图片等。
  2. 数据一致性:将图片路径保存在数据库中可以确保图片数据的一致性和完整性,避免图片丢失或路径错误的问题。
  3. 简化备份和迁移:将图片路径保存在数据库中可以简化数据库的备份和迁移操作,只需备份或迁移数据库文件即可。

应用场景:

  1. 网络相册:在网站或应用中创建相册功能时,可以将每张图片的路径保存在数据库中,方便用户浏览和管理相册。
  2. 电子商务:在电子商务平台中,商品图片的路径可以保存在数据库中,方便商品展示和管理。
  3. 社交媒体:社交媒体应用中用户上传的图片可以保存在数据库中,方便用户分享和查看。

腾讯云相关产品: 腾讯云提供了多个与数据库相关的产品,以下是其中一些常用产品及其介绍链接地址:

  1. 云数据库 MySQL:腾讯云的托管型MySQL数据库服务,提供高性能、高可靠性的数据库解决方案。链接:https://cloud.tencent.com/product/cdb
  2. 云数据库 CynosDB for MySQL:腾讯云的兼容MySQL协议的分布式数据库服务,适用于大规模的数据存储和查询场景。链接:https://cloud.tencent.com/product/cynosdb-for-mysql

注意:在答案中不能提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,因此只能提及腾讯云相关产品作为示例。实际情况下,还有其他云计算品牌商也提供与MySQL相关的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

mysql 数据库数据文件保存路径更改

mysql 数据安装的时候默认的数据库文件保存路径是在C:\ProgramData\MySQL\MySQL Server 5.5\data文件下的,但是我们安装数据库在服务器上的时候往往是不要在...C盘,所有我们就想要把数据保存的文件给更改了,那我们就来看看这样该怎么样来操作呢?  ...首先,我们必须把我们的Mysql 数据的服务给停掉,在cmd 输入net stop mysql (停掉mysql 数据库)      ,但是我们往往可能碰到的情况是你所用的用户是不具备这种权限的,那么我们只能够管理里面把...mysql 数据库给停了,然后才是真正的操作:   1、新建文件夹D:\mysql\data(这是你自己希望的保存路径);   2、找到你的数据库数据文件默认的保存路径(C:\ProgramData\MySQL...5.5/Data/" datadir="D:\mysql\data"(D:/mysql/data这种写法好像的是行的,你可以自己去试试看)   4、重新启动mysql服务 cmd输入:net start

6.7K10
  • Tomcat配置图片等附件保存路径

    问题 图片等附件在项目路径下,存在重新部署附件丢失的情况,为了保证图片等附件的安全性,单独配置图片等附件的保存路径和URL访问路径是可行的方案。...这里可为 path="/"或path="" docBase:指定Web应用的文件路径,可以给定绝对路径,也可以给定相对于的appBase属性的相对路径,如果Web应用采用开放目录结构,则指定...步骤2 java后端上传程序处理 //图片存储路径与webapps下的工程目录分离,保证图片等附 String contextRealPath = request.getSession().getServletContext...().getRealPath("/"); //调整文件上传的保存目录 savePath = new File(contextRealPath).getParentFile().getParentFile...().getAbsolutePath() + "/"+ basePath + "/"; // 文件保存目录URL saveUrl = "/doctor-interface-upload" + "/" +

    1.2K20

    解决小程序的图片路径mysql数据库访问的问题

    一.问题过程现象描述: 1,在mysql数据库正常访问的时候,图片路径访问失败(mysql先用80端口测试,之后用的443端口): 之前是打开服务器目录下的图片链接报错是404:...image.png 2.关闭80端口之后,mysql数据库也不能正常访问: ①后来在服务器命令行,查看占用的端口的进程: netstat -alnp | grep 80 kill...-9 删除进程号 image.png ②打开服务器目录下的图片链接报错是503: image.png 二.解决问题的的分析: 1.mysql数据库用的是Tomcat(先后用的端口是80和443)...,mysql数据库不能正常启动: image.png image.png 4.关闭nginx,启动mysql数据库 nginx停止方式: systemctl stop nginx mysql数据库启动...总结,解决Tomcat和nginx的环境端口(443、80)配置的问题,图片路径mysql数据库的都可以正常访问。

    3.1K00

    unityapplication(3D自动保存路径)

    便花时间认真研究了一下Unity3D的路径问题。...Documents目录,这个目录用于存储需要长期保存的数据,比如我们的热更新内容就写在这里。需要注意的是,iCloud会自动备份此目录,如果此目录下写入的内容较多,审核的可能会被苹果拒掉。...打开会发现里面有4个目录(需要root)     cache 缓存目录,类似于iOS的Cache目录     databases 数据库文件目录     files 类似于iOS的Documents...经反复测试发现,有【外置SD卡】的设备上,如果声明读/写外部存储设备的权限,会返回外部存储路径,不声明则会返回内部存储路径,这样不会有问题。...com.CompanyName.ProductName.plist 参考: iOS Data Storage Guidelines Android API: Storage Options 彻底理解Android的内部存储与外部存储

    1.1K20

    MySQL查看数据库安装路径

    有时候在我们开发的过程并不一定记得数据库的安装路径。...比如要查看MySQL 数据库的安装目录在哪里: 我们可以通过mysql命令查看mysql的安装路径: # 以下两个sql任意一个可查询 select @@basedir as basePath from...dual ; show variables like '%basedir%'; 上面可以看到基础的安装路径,查看数据库data的路径怎么看,很简单,把上面的参数变量换成datadir即可: # 以下查询任意一个均可...,那么朋友会问,如果也不知道登录mysql 的账户密码,那又如何在查看mysql路径呢?...方法一: 1:查询运行文件所在路径 which mysql 然后可通过 /usr/bin/mysql -u账号 -p密码 连接Mysql: 然后执行上面的任意一个MySQL查看安装路径

    11.4K20

    .Net之使用Jquery Ajax通过FormData对象异步提交图片文件到服务端保存并返回保存图片路径

    前言:   首先对于图片上传而言,在我们的项目开发可以说出现的频率是相当的高的。...这篇文章,我将要描述的是在我们.Net如何使用Jquery Ajax通过FormData对象异步提交图片文件到后台保存,并返回保存图片路径展示出图片,实现一个无刷新的异步图片上传的过程,当然这里我讲解的是单张图片保存过程...上传多张图片到服务端保存。...78 79 // 文件上传后的保存路径 80 string basePath = "UploadFile"; 81 string saveDir = DateTime.Now.ToString...System.IO.Directory.CreateDirectory(serverDir); 88 } 89 string fileNme = System.IO.Path.Combine(serverDir, saveName);//保存文件完整路径

    2.1K20

    matlab保存所有图,Matlab图片保存的5种方法

    x=-pi:2*pi/300:pi; y=sin(x); plot(x,y); %Matlab根据文件扩展名,自动保存为相应格式图片,另外路径可以是绝对也可以是相对 print(gcf,’-dpng’...,’abc.png’) %保存为png格式的图片到当前路径 复制代码 另外有网友向我反映,有时我们只有一个Matlab图像的fig文件,但没有该图像的相关坐标数据,那我们如何获取fig图像的数据呢,...这个其实比较好办 1、将那个fig文件保存到Matlab的搜索路径下,双击打开它 2、在Matlab的command输入如下内容 h=get(gcf,’chidren’) data=get(h,{‘xdata.../details/8111956 Matlab图片保存的四种方法 matlab的绘图和可视化能力是不用多说的,可以说在业内是家喻户晓的.Matlab提供了丰富的绘图函数,比如ez**系类的简易绘图函数...c … CSS隐藏内容的3种方法 CSS隐藏内容的3种方法 一般有:隐藏文本/图片.隐藏链接.隐藏超出范围的内容.隐藏弹出层.隐藏滚动条.清除错位和浮动等. 1.使用display:none来隐藏所有内容

    8.6K11

    matlab如何读取路径下所有图片_matlab保存到指定文件夹

    之前的matlab学习接触了各种图片的处理方式和算法函数,现在考虑的是如何保存和输出图片 matlab图片保存方式 imwrite函数 imwrite函数是和imread函数配套的图片读取输出函数...,写法和imread函数一样 imwrite(I,‘lena.jpg’) 需要注意的是在保存之前需要保存一个句柄 I=getimage(gcf) 但是问题在于imwrite函数保存图片是已经定义过的图片...在以下代码中使用imwrite函数保存的并不是修改后的图片,而是修改之前的图片Y clear; clc; X=imread(‘abc.bmp’); Y=zeros(size(X)); figure,imshow...就是说这样的办法会还原之前的处理,在这里不适合使用 saveas函数 saveas函数可以将指定figure的图像或者simulink的框图进行保存,相当于【文件】的【另存为】,这样的功能更加适合我的需求...它有三种书写方式 saveas(gcf,[‘D:\保存的数据文件\方法1.png’]) saveas(gcf,[‘D:\保存的数据文件\方法2’,’.png’])</ 版权声明:本文内容由互联网用户自发贡献

    1.5K10

    MySQLSQL语句优化路径

    日常的应用开发可能需要优化SQL,提高数据访问和应用响应的效率,不同的SQL,优化的具体方案可能会有所不同,但是路径上,还是存在一些共性的。...碰巧看到杨老师的这篇文章《第45期:一条 SQL 语句优化的基本思路》,为我们优化一些MySQL数据库的SQL语句提供了可借鉴的路径,值得参考和应用。 SQL语句优化是一个既熟悉又陌生的话题。...以MySQL为例,一条SQL语句从客户端发出到数据库端返回结果一般会经历几个阶段:词法解析、语法解析、语义解析、逻辑优化、物理优化、最终执行并返回结果。...物理优化可以理解为数据库按照当前SQL语句涉及到的表统计信息、列统计信息、索引个数、索引优劣、当前运行负载、当前硬件资源等可变因素来决定如何生成最优执行路径的方法。...虽然上面说的是MySQL数据库,但是一些理论上,其他的关系型数据库都是可以借鉴的。

    2K10
    领券